package org.eclipse.gemini.blueprint.blueprint.reflect;
import java.util.List;
import java.util.Set;
import org.osgi.service.blueprint.reflect.CollectionMetadata;
import org.osgi.service.blueprint.reflect.Metadata;
import org.springframework.util.StringUtils;
/**
* Basic {@link CollectionMetadata} implementation.
*
* @author Costin Leau
*/
class SimpleCollectionMetadata implements CollectionMetadata {
public enum CollectionType {
ARRAY(Object[].class), LIST(List.class), SET(Set.class);
private final Class<?> type;
private CollectionType(Class<?> type) {
this.type = type;
}
static CollectionType resolve(Class<?> type) {
for (CollectionType supportedType : CollectionType.values()) {
if (supportedType.type.equals(type)) {
return supportedType;
}
}
throw new IllegalArgumentException("Unsupported class type " + type);
}
}
private final List<Metadata> values;
private final CollectionType collectionType;
private final String typeName;
public SimpleCollectionMetadata(List<Metadata> values, CollectionType type, String valueTypeName) {
this.values = values;
this.collectionType = type;
this.typeName = (StringUtils.hasText(valueTypeName) ? valueTypeName : null);
}
public SimpleCollectionMetadata(List<Metadata> values, Class<?> type, String valueTypeName) {
this(values, CollectionType.resolve(type), valueTypeName);
}
public Class<?> getCollectionClass() {
return collectionType.type;
}
public String getValueType() {
return typeName;
}
public List<Metadata> getValues() {
return values;
}
}
